Ruby

Ruby stone is a precious gemstone that is a variety of the mineral corundum. It is known for its deep red colour, which is caused by the presence of small amounts of chromium. The most valuable rubies are those that are a deep, vibrant red and have a high level of transparency.

Ruby stone is one of the most durable gemstones,ranking 9 on the Mohs scale of mineral hardness, making it an excellent choice for jewellery such as rings and bracelets that are worn daily. Its strength ensures long-lasting brilliance even with regular use.

Chemically, ruby is composed of Aluminium Oxide (Al₂O₃) and belongs to the Corundum group, the same mineral family as sapphire. Its stunning colour range varies from pinkish-red to deep blood red, with the highly coveted “pigeon blood red” ruby being the most valuable due to its intense and vivid hue.

Unheated and heat-treated rubies differ mainly in how their color and clarity are achieved. Unheated rubies are completely natural, with no enhancement, making them rarer and often more valuable, especially for astrological purposes. Heat-treated rubies undergo controlled heating to improve color and clarity, which is widely accepted in the gemstone industry. Both types are genuine natural rubies, but unheated stones typically command a higher price due to their rarity. Rubies are found in several parts of the world, including Myanmar (Burma), Sri Lanka, Thailand, Mozambique, and India. The origin of a ruby plays a significant role in determining its quality and value. Among them, Burmese rubies are especially prized for their rich, vibrant red colour and exceptional clarity, making them some of the finest rubies available globally.
